我正在尝试创建一个应用程序在flutter,有像youtube的功能,播放视频,搜索视频。我需要实现和使迷你播放器活跃像在youtube在多个屏幕像在图书馆,订阅部分。有没有办法在不同页面之间切换时保持视频的状态?在我所附的图像中,我在订阅页面,但迷你播放器仍在播放。有什么办法可以在Flutter中实现吗?
我可以通过提供URL从互联网上播放视频,但当我必须导航到新屏幕时,我无法实现迷你播放器。
kadbb4591#
您需要使用pub.dev中的miniplayer包。只需使用基本版本:
Stack( children: <Widget>[ YourApp(), Miniplayer( minHeight: 70, maxHeight: 370, builder: (height, percentage) { return Center( child: Text('$height, $percentage'), ); }, ), ], ),
你可以用这个软件包创建Youtube迷你播放器的精确副本。
1条答案
按热度按时间kadbb4591#
您需要使用pub.dev中的miniplayer包。只需使用基本版本:
你可以用这个软件包创建Youtube迷你播放器的精确副本。